NDLEA Seizes Large Cache of Illicit Drugs Across Seven States, Arrests 15 Suspects
The National Drug Law Enforcement Agency (NDLEA) has intercepted significant quantities of illicit drugs in a series of coordinated raids across seven states, arresting 15 suspects in the process.
The operations, carried out between Wednesday and Saturday last week, led to the seizure of banned substances including Tramadol, opioids, methamphetamine, cannabis, cocaine, and heroin, according to NDLEA spokesperson Femi Babafemi.
In Kano State, a suspected trafficker was apprehended with 36,000 pills of Tramadol along the Danbatta-Kazaure road on Wednesday. Two days later, operatives in Gombe arrested a suspect at the Gombe Roundabout with 25,000 pills of Tramadol and Exol-5. On the same day, two more suspects were nabbed in Kwadom, Yemaltu Deba LGA, with 49 blocks of compressed skunk weighing 29kg.
In Borno State, NDLEA officers intercepted 74,360 opioid pills from a 44-year-old suspect traveling in a Mercedes Benz along Baga Road, Maiduguri, on Saturday.
A separate intelligence-led operation in Narayi High Cost area of Chikun LGA, Kaduna State, resulted in the arrest of three suspects the same day.
In Bayelsa, a 63-year-old grandmother was caught with 163 liters of “skuchies” — a locally brewed psychoactive substance — in the Osiri area of Yenagoa on Thursday.
Along the Okene-Lokoja highway in Kogi State, four suspects were apprehended while transporting 2kg of methamphetamine from Onitsha to Minna.
In Abia State, a notorious drug dealer’s base was raided, with officers recovering quantities of Tramadol, cocaine, heroin, methamphetamine, and N736,000 in cash.
Also, a popular hotel in Lagos State—allegedly run as a family operation—was raided for distributing party drugs. The NDLEA seized 1.3kg of cannabis, 900g of cannabis-infused gummies, 22.9g of skunk, and impounded three vehicles from the premises.
The NDLEA says it remains committed to intensifying its nationwide crackdown on drug trafficking and abuse.
